Output 28014fba843c151669290651636c9c45245b38c73a70250d3ab03961a26da21a:1

value
1235913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46538537ad489c74d092ab4839d214bfdaee0c5b OP_EQUAL
address
386sH4zeW6ZtPNwWShXzfJm67cqhBPY3Gw
transaction
28014fba843c151669290651636c9c45245b38c73a70250d3ab03961a26da21a
spent
true